What is an effective strategy for managing time during the CBEST?

Pacing oneself and allocating specific time for each section is an effective strategy for managing time during the CBEST because it allows candidates to approach each part of the exam with a clear plan. By determining how much time to spend on each section in advance, test-takers can ensure that they allocate enough time to read questions carefully, consider their responses, and avoid the stress that comes from running out of time. This approach enhances focus and allows for better performance, as it reduces the likelihood of feeling rushed or overwhelmed.

In contrast, reading all questions at once can lead to confusion and make it harder to keep track of time effectively, while skipping difficult questions may result in missing out on points that could have been secured with careful consideration. Rushing through sections often leads to careless mistakes and a lack of thorough understanding of the questions, which can significantly lower overall scores. The strategy of pacing and time allocation strikes a balance between thoroughness and efficiency, making it the most reliable approach for the exam.
